Why RHEV can not be installed like any other modules such as high-availability or jboss
 
Dear Friends,

I was just checking out with RHEV(RedHat Enterprise Vitualization) environment and found that its mandatory to subscribe with RHN to setup RHEV environment ( i.e, to be able to install rhev packages).
Since past few days I am trying hard to find a way-out to set-up RHEV without subscription either on RHEL or Cent OS but didn't got any success.

Can anyone advice why it is required to subscribe with RHN to download and install rhev packages, whereas we can install JBOSS or high-availability without doing so?
Also, why this case is with particularly with RHEV only?

Because RHEV is like RHEL, you need to pay for the subscription. It's how Red Hat makes their money. You don't want to pay for it then use something else (RHEV is based on ovirt so you could install that).
